Summary Strain L21‐Ace‐BES T , isolated from a lithifying cyanobacterial mat, could be assigned to a novel species and genus within the class Deferribacteres . It is an important model organism for the study of anaerobic acetate degradation under hypersaline conditions. Summary Anaerobic strains affiliated with a novel order‐level lineage of the Phycisphaerae class were retrieved from the suboxic zone of a hypersaline cyanobacterial mat and anoxic sediments of solar salterns. Genome sequences of five isolates were obtained and compared with metagenome‐assembled genomes representing related uncultured bacteria from various anoxic aquatic environments. Summary The anaerobic, mesophilic and moderately halophilic strain L21‐Spi‐D4 T was recently isolated from the suboxic zone of a hypersaline cyanobacterial mat using protein‐rich extracts of Arthrospira (formerly Spirulina ) platensis as substrate.
